MTSS/Special Education Resource Room Teacher
Job Posting
Required Qualifications:
- Appropriate Michigan Certification required or be able to obtain temporary approval as a Special Education Teacher as per Michigan Department of Special Education Rules (340.1781 and 1782).
- Meet requirements for a background check and fingerprinting.
- Alternate applicable qualifications may be considered.
Preferred Qualifications:
- A knowledge of reading science and an understanding of current best practices in reading instruction.
- Experience progress monitoring in reading and math.
- Experience providing reading/math interventions within the context of a broader MTSS program or special education setting.
Job Requirements, Knowledge, and Skills:
- Successful experience working with students with disabilities.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
- Knowledge of content expectations/standards.
- Knowledge of best practices in classroom instruction and technology integration.
- Experience working as part of a collaborative team.
A successful candidate will:
- Complete assessments of students and based upon those assessments will develop Individualized Educational Plans for those students; including the development of the Present Level of Academic Achievement and Functional Performance (PLAAFP), Identification of Unique Individualized Educational needs, and Goals and Instructional Objectives for students assigned to their caseloads.
- Be responsible for the instructional planning for the classroom and the delivery or direction of instructional activities in the classroom and other settings within the school.
- Develop, provide, and utilize instructional plans, strategies, methods, materials, and techniques that best meet the needs of individual students.
- Provide leadership, direction, and oversight of the paraprofessional(s) within the classroom environment.
- Work as a part of building MTSS teams to provide intervention and progress monitoring for students.
- Timely and accurately complete required and necessary paperwork, including but not limited to lesson plans, emergency plans/data, allergy plans, progress reports, behavioral support plans/documentation, Functional Behavioral Assessments, etc.
- Communicate appropriately and effectively with parents in writing and verbally.
- Participate as part of a work team and work effectively with others within the school environment.
- Attend required workshops, in-services, and training.
- Other duties as assigned by administration.
